Amroth community dippers entered the brinny on New Year’s Day celebrating 37 years of the event.

This year, some 60 dippers entred the beach from the castle slipway, which proved to be a safe entry for both the entrants, and onlookers.

The hundreds of onlookers were able to access the beach for safe viewing and interact with dippers.

It has now been decided the community New Year’s Day dippers will make this popular venue their home for future swims, which had the local businesses bustling through out the day, with festive revellers celebrating the turn of the year.

For those wishing to support the local branch of Cancer Research UK in memory of Ann Kingston, the chosen fancy dress theme was penguins.
